Simple Press forum, slow site
 
Hi everyone,

I recently installed the simple press forum and I noticed my site has gotten a lot slower (in terms of loading). I plan on adding at least on more page and in the future some type of login, which can only mean itll get slower? How do I solve this? any suggestions? Thanks!

There are a number of things that can cause a site to slow down, including image size, number of scripts and css files, etc. Each plugin used normally adds additional files to the wp_head or wp_footer that your site must load. If one particular plugin is causing your site to slow, you may want to try contacting the plugin author to see if he or she has some suggestions.

Try one of the caching plugins if you are not already using one.

A lot of articles have been written and indexed by google regarding speeding up WordPress. Also, consider getting Firebug for Firefox with YSlow - links are in my signature.
